In this episode of The Asian Soup Podcast, Rox and Jules chat about facing the realities of their parents getting older and older. They revisit their childhood and how their parents dealt with their own ageing parents (our grandparents). It’s only human that we all get older, now we’re also in our mid-30s. What do we foresee for any upcoming responsibilities that we might have in the future with our parents? Is there anything that we already need to deal with? Are there any Asian Australian cultural expectations of filial piety that we have? Everyone’s family situations are different, and how we take care of our ageing parents will also differ. A bit of a more personal take on family and what’s to come. Hopefully, you enjoy and can relate to some of the things we share in this episode. Tune in for another cosy conversation.
